Abstract
A safety needle is disclosed having a puncture needle with a needle lumen and a ground tip; a holding device that, during use, bears on the skin of a patient and holds the puncture needle; and a safety mechanism with a protection element that has a first, opened state and a second, closed state. When the holding device is taken away from the skin and/or when the holding device is moved with respect to the defined position, the safety mechanism automatically moves the protection element from a first position, in which the tip of the needle is exposed, to a second position, in which the tip of the needle is covered as the protection element at the same time transfers automatically from the first, opened state to the second, closed state.
